The year-end concert of the Asian International Montessori School in Battaramulla was held recently at the Bishops College Auditorium on the theme ‘Global Rhythm’. Nearly 200 students performed meticulously choreographed dance and song items to a packed full house.

The audience was taken on a journey around the world depicting the cultural heritage of different countries and continents set against beautiful props and backdrops handcrafted by the teachers themselves.

From tribal dances in Africa to the Hill Billy dances of North America, Dances of the Pharaoh to Parasol Dances of Japan and beautifully executed traditional Greek dances, to a very colourful traditional Russian dance. The evening culminated with our own Sri Lanka Baila ‘Remix Karala’ which the kids thoroughly enjoyed. Special mention should be made of the beautiful costumes that brought to life the dance items while transporting the audience to their original settings.

The large gathering of parents, grandparents and well-wishers were kept spell bound as toddlers to tiny tots exhibited their in-born talents skillfully nurtured by a group of equally talented and committed teachers.

Hats off to the AIS Montessori School for staging a splendid performance and bringing down the curtain on yet another successful year.
